What's the Climate Like?

Monthly averages — select a city to compare.

Santo Domingo Rain: 57.0 in/yr (1447 mm)
87° / 71°F

Avg. annual high / low

Lusaka Rain: 31.4 in/yr (798 mm)
80° / 59°F

Avg. annual high / low

Months Santo Domingo Lusaka
Jan–Mar 85°/67°F (29°/20°C) 80°/62°F (27°/17°C)
Apr–Jun 87°/72°F (30°/22°C) 77°/55°F (25°/13°C)
Jul–Sep 89°/73°F (31°/23°C) 79°/55°F (26°/13°C)
Oct–Dec 87°/71°F (30°/21°C) 85°/64°F (29°/18°C)

Visitor Visa Requirements

Short-stay tourist visa rules between Dominican Republic and Zambia. To live, work, or study long-term in Zambia, you'll need a separate residence or work visa — check Zambia's immigration authority.

Dominican Republic passport

Dominican Republic passport holder visiting Zambia

Visa Free
Dominican Republic passport holders can enter Zambia without a visa.
Zambia passport

Zambia passport holder visiting Dominican Republic

Visa Required
Zambia passport holders need a visa to enter Dominican Republic.

Data: Henley Passport Index. Check with the destination country's embassy for the most current requirements.
